    How to Hide or Show Preview Handlers in Preview Pane of File Explorer in Windows 10

    information   Information
    The preview pane in File Explorer shows you the contents of a file, such as image or text files, without having to open it with an app.

    Preview handlers show the content of text type files (ex: .bat, .html, .txt, etc...) in the preview pane.

    This tutorial will show you how to hide or show preview handlers in preview pane of File Explorer for your account in Windows 10.

    Note   Note
    Setting to hide or show preview handlers in the preview pane will not affect showing a preview of image files.

    OPTION ONE

    To Hide or Show Preview Handlers in Preview Pane using Folder Options


    1. Open Folder Options.

    2. Click/tap on the View tab, check (default) or uncheck Show preview handlers in preview pane in "Advanced settings" for what you want, and click/tap on OK. (see screenshot below)

    OPTION TWO

    To Hide or Show Preview Handlers in Preview Pane using a REG file


    Note   Note
    The .reg files below will modify the DWORD value in the registry key below.

    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Advanced

    ShowPreviewHandlers DWORD

    0 = Hide
    1 = Show


    1. Do step 2 (hide) or step 3 (show) below for what you would like to do.

    4. Save the .reg file to your desktop.

    5. Double click/tap on the downloaded .reg file to merge it.

    6. If prompted, click/tap on Run, Yes (UAC), Yes, and OK to approve the merge.

    7. If you currently have File Explorer open, then refresh (F5) the window to apply.

    8. If you like, you can now delete the downloaded .reg file.
